Automatic Animal Feed Dispensing System

Modern farms are constantly seeking ways to enhance efficiency and reduce labor costs. One innovative solution is the adoption of automated animal feed dispensing systems. These advanced systems provide a consistent method for delivering precise amounts of feed to animals on schedule. Benefits extend to reduced feed waste, improved animal health through consistent nutrition, and enhanced productivity for farm operators.

  • Commonly, these systems feature a central control unit, sensors, and an automated feeding mechanism.
  • Using sensors, the system can monitor feed levels, animal weight, and even feeding patterns.
  • Furthermore, some systems can be integrated with other farm management software to provide comprehensive data reporting on animal performance and feed efficiency.

Precision Livestock Farming: Feed Efficiency Through Technology

Farmers are constantly seeking ways to maximize the efficiency of their operations. One area where technology is making a significant impact is in feed management. Data-driven animal husbandry uses sensors, data analytics, and other tools to monitor individual animals and optimize their feed rations. This approach can result to significant improvements in feed efficiency, which means that animals convert more of the feed they consume into growth. PLF systems can also help identify health issues early on, reducing the need for antibiotics and improving overall animal welfare.

Furthermore, by collecting and analyzing data on feed consumption, weight gain, and other factors, farmers can acquire useful knowledge into their livestock's performance. This information can be used to refine feeding strategies, promote healthy flocks, and ultimately increase profitability.
